Close vision (clear vision at 20 inches or less); Distance Vision (clear vision at 20 feet or more); Color Vision (ability to identify and distinguish colors); Peripheral Vision (ability to observe an area that can be seen up and down or to the left and right while eyes are fixed on a given point); Depth Perception (three-dimensional vision, ability to judge distances and spatial relationships); Ability to Adjust Focus (ability to adjust the eye to bring an object into sharp focus.

How do Employers Verify Education?
At any stage in your professional journey, you may come across an employer or a recruiter who asks to verify your educational credentials. This shouldn’t come as a surprise as 30% of candidates admitted to lying on their resumes, yet 79% of them never get caught. In fact, 85% of employers in the US who conduct background checks find that candidates have lied on their resumes or job applications.
